Description

A sprinkler for local anesthetic of throat
Technical Field
The utility model belongs to the technical field of the anesthesia, concretely relates to a sprinkler for local anesthetic of throat.
Background
Anesthesia is reversible functional inhibition of central nerve and peripheral nervous system generated by medicine or other methods, the inhibition is characterized in that the sensation, especially the pain sensation is lost, the anesthesia means that the patient loses the sensation wholly or locally by medicine or other methods temporarily so as to achieve the purpose of painless operation treatment, the anesthesiology is a science which applies the basic theory, clinical knowledge and technology related to anesthesia to eliminate the operation pain of the patient, ensures the safety of the patient and creates good conditions for the operation, the anesthesiology now becomes a special independent subject in clinical medicine, mainly comprises the research of clinical anesthesiology, emergency resuscitation medicine, critical monitoring and treatment science, pain diagnosis and treatment science and other related medicine and mechanism, is a comprehensive subject of research of anesthesia, analgesia, emergency resuscitation and critical medicine, wherein the clinical anesthesia is the main part of modern anesthesiology, the range of modern anaesthesia can also be divided into the following categories: clinical anesthesia, intensive care, emergency resuscitation, and pain management.
The prior art has the following problems:
1. in the prior art, when a patient uses the throat for anesthesia, the dosage of anesthetic cannot be well controlled, and the patient is not convenient to be anesthetized;
2. when anesthesia is used, a patient can be nervous or even coma due to self reasons, medical care personnel cannot timely treat the patient, and potential safety hazards exist.

Example 1
Referring to fig. 1-4, the present invention provides the following technical solutions: the utility model provides a sprinkler for local anesthetic of throat, including narcotic jar 1, nozzle 3 and shower nozzle 7, narcotic jar 1's upper end is connected with shower nozzle 7, the output of shower nozzle 7 is connected with nozzle 3, lateral wall one side of narcotic jar 1 is connected with injection syringe 8, narcotic jar 1's lateral wall front surface is connected with scale 2, nozzle 3 keeps away from the one end of shower nozzle 7 and can dismantle through connecting pipe 5 and be connected useful pencil 4, nozzle 3's lateral wall is connected with face guard assembly 6.
In this embodiment: medical personnel need according to patient's physique, then pass through injection tube 8 with the appropriate narcotic of dose and the syringe injects anesthetic jar 1 in, then observe scale 2 and ensure the volume of narcotic, reach the effect that the narcotic was sprayed to the ration, avoid using too much or too little, medical personnel will insert patient's throat with pencil 4, directly spray the narcotic to the throat, face guard subassembly 6 places the nose at the patient this moment, help the patient to breathe, avoid symptoms such as dyspnea to appear in the patient.
Specifically, the inner side wall of the connecting pipe 5 is connected with the inserting pipe 51, the outer side wall of the nozzle 3 is provided with the inserting groove 31, and the inserting pipe 51 and the inserting groove 31 are inserted and fixed; can peg graft fixedly through grafting pipe 51 and inserting groove 31 between connecting pipe 5 and the nozzle 3, medical personnel can insert patient's throat with pencil 4 earlier promptly, then link together anesthesia gallipot 1 and pencil 4 with using, make things convenient for medical personnel to carry out work.
Specifically, the administration tube 4 is a flexible member; the medicine tube 4 is a flexible member and can be bent, and the bent medicine tube 4 can prevent the medicine tube 4 from falling into the body of a patient and is convenient to insert into the throat of the patient.
Specifically, the mask assembly 6 comprises a breathing mask 61 and an oxygen inhalation tube 62, wherein the breathing mask 61 is connected to one side of the mask assembly 6, and the oxygen inhalation tube 62 is connected below the mask assembly 6; the respiratory mask 61 is placed on the nose of the patient, and is connected with external oxygen through the oxygen inhalation tube 62, so that the patient is helped to breathe, and the symptoms of dyspnea and the like of the patient are avoided.
Specifically, one side of the injection tube 8, which is far away from the anesthetic canister 1, is connected with a protective cap 81; when the injection tube 8 is not used, the protective cap 81 can be sleeved on the injection tube 8, so that the effect of protection and dust prevention is achieved.
Specifically, the injection tube 8 is arranged obliquely, and the inclination angle is not lower than 45 degrees; the injection tube 8 is arranged in an upward inclined manner, so that the backflow of the liquid medicine can be avoided.
Specifically, the outer side wall of the injection tube 8 is connected with a dustproof pad 9, and the dustproof pad 9 is arranged on the outer side wall of the anesthetic canister 1; dustproof pad 9 can avoid during external impurity passes through the gap entering anaesthetic jar 1 between injection tube 8 and the anaesthetic jar 1, reaches the dustproof effect of protection.
The utility model discloses a theory of operation and use flow: medical personnel according to the requirements of the constitution of a patient, then the anesthetic with proper dosage is injected into the anesthetic tank 1 through the injection tube 8 and the injector, then the scale 2 is observed to ensure the amount of the anesthetic, the effect of quantitatively spraying the anesthetic is achieved, too much or too little medication is avoided, the medical personnel can insert the medicine tube 4 into the throat of the patient firstly, then the anesthetic tank 1 and the medicine tube 4 are connected together, the work of the medical personnel is facilitated, the medical personnel uses the spray head 7 to directly spray the anesthetic on the throat, at the moment, the breathing mask 61 is placed on the nose of the patient, and external oxygen is accessed through the oxygen suction tube 62, the breathing of the patient is helped, the symptoms such as the breathing difficulty of the patient are avoided, when the injection tube 8 is not used, the protective cap 81 can be sleeved on the injection tube 8, the dustproof effect is achieved, the dustproof pad 9 can prevent external impurities from entering the anesthetic tank 1 through the gap between the injection tube 8 and the anesthetic tank 1, the dustproof effect of protection is reached.
